LogiNext Mile features and specs

  • Real-time tracking
    Offers real-time tracking of deliveries, enhancing visibility and enabling quicker response times to potential issues.
  • Route optimization
    Automatically optimizes delivery routes to minimize travel time and fuel consumption, improving efficiency and reducing costs.
  • Scalability
    Can scale operations up or down based on business needs, making it suitable for both small and large enterprises.
  • Customer notifications
    Provides automatic notifications to customers regarding delivery status, enhancing customer satisfaction and communication.
  • Analytics and reporting
    Offers comprehensive analytics and reporting tools to help businesses understand performance metrics and identify areas for improvement.
  • Integration capabilities
    Can seamlessly integrate with various ERP and CRM systems, offering a smooth flow of information across different platforms.
  • Driver management
    Includes features for efficient driver management, such as assigning tasks, tracking performance, and ensuring compliance.

Analysis of LogiNext Mile

Overall verdict

  • LogiNext Mile is a robust solution for businesses looking to optimize their logistics and field service operations. It is highly regarded for its comprehensive features and ability to integrate seamlessly into existing systems, making it a worthwhile investment for companies of various sizes.

Why this product is good

  • LogiNext Mile is praised for its advanced logistics and field service management capabilities. The platform offers real-time tracking, route optimization, and analytics, which help companies improve efficiency and reduce operational costs. Its AI-driven engine automates delivery operations, leading to increased customer satisfaction and streamlined processes.
